ABOUT 

As part of quality initiatives, MKJC underwent evaluation and accreditation by NAAC for the first time on November 17, 2006, and obtained Grade of "B++" in the first cycle. On January 5, 2013, our Institution secured "A" grade from NAAC in Second cycle, and again secured ‘A’ Grade in the third cycle of Assessment from NAAC on July 15, 2019.

As a post-accreditation quality maintenance strategy, the National Assessment and Accreditation Council (NAAC), Bangalore, recommends that each recognized institution create an Internal Quality Assurance Cell (IQAC).

We at Marudhar Kesari Jain College for Women in Vaniyambadi established the Internal Quality Assurance Cell (IQAC) on November 17, 2006 in accordance with NAAC guidelines for the creation of IQAC in order to ensure quality culture as the primary concern for the Institution through institutionalizing and internalizing all the initiative taken with support from both internal and external sources.

The main goal of the IQAC is to create a system for consciously, consistently, and catalytically improving institutions' overall performance. All of the institution's activities and initiatives are directed by IQAC towards developing its all-encompassing academic excellence. The IQAC is responsible for ensuring that the institution takes all necessary steps to improve the quality of education in a rapid, efficient, and high-standard manner.

The IQAC sets up methods and procedures to gather data and information on many facets of Institutional functioning. The participation of all IQAC members in all activities is essential to the organization's success. The institution's interactive quality assurance committee, or IQAC, is a dynamic structure that may help improve the institution's quality culture and address flaws.

Under the leadership of the institution's head, the IQAC is formed with the heads of significant academic and administrative units, a small number of instructors, a few eminent educators, and representatives of the local management, industrialists, and stakeholders.

Additionally, the IQAC routinely publishes the college news letter, which details all college activities, most of which are related to academic achievements of students, professors, and office employees. The website www.mkjc.in hosts this bulletin online as well.

 FUNCTIONS
  • Creating and implementing quality benchmarks and criteria in all of the institution's activities;
  • Analyzing and evaluating the institution's quality indicators.
  • Serving as the institution's nodal organization for tasks relating to quality.
  • The creation and filing of the Annual Quality Assurance Report (AQAR) in accordance with the standards and limitations established by NAAC, as well as any other reports that may be agreed upon from time to time.

 

Functions of the IQAC:

  • The creation and adoption of quality standards/benchmarks for the College's numerous administrative and academic initiatives.
  • Supporting faculty development to embrace the necessary knowledge and technology for participative teaching and learning processes, as well as the construction of a learner-centric environment favorable for high-quality education.
  • Setting up mechanisms for parents, students, and other stakeholders to provide input on institutional procedures that affect quality.
  • Planning seminars on quality-related topics, inter- and intra-institutional workshops
  • The extensive documentation of the College's varied programs and activities, which results in quality enhancement.
  • Serving as the College's core organization for coordinating quality-related initiatives, such as the adoption and promotion of best practices.
  • The construction and preservation of institutional databases using MIS in order to preserve or improve the caliber of the institution. 
  • It also supports the creation of a culture of excellence at the college.
  • Creating the College's Annual Quality Assurance Report (AQAR) in accordance with the format required and using the quality parameters/assessment criteria specified by the NAAC.
  • In accordance with the UGC Regulations 2010, the IQAC will serve as the cell for documentation and record-keeping.
